2015-06-22 480 views
1

在HTML中,標題用<H>(1,2,3,4,5,6)標記表示。標題標籤的默認CSS樣式是什麼? (H1,h2,h3,h4,h5)

我的問題是關於下面的HTML代碼:

<div class="pure-u-1-1 pure-u-lg-3-3"> 
    <h3><form:label path="gen">Registrer Bruker</form:label></h3> 
</div> 

<H3>的相反,我想要寫在CSS類的財產;它給出相同的字體大小(外觀和感覺);如標題HTML給出的。在CSS中也有相同的預定義屬性?

+3

請修復你的語法,這是很難理解的。 – fauverism

+0

[CSS類是否可以繼承一個或多個其他類?](http://stackoverflow.com/questions/1065435/can-a-css-class-inherit-one-or-more-other-classes) – JBux

+0

@違規主義爲什麼你想這樣做? –

回答

2

答案是否定的,但是你可能會破解樣式。大多數瀏覽器將嘗試使用這些樣式

(來自:w3schools

h1 { 
    display: block; 
    font-size: 2em; 
    margin-top: 0.67em; 
    margin-bottom: 0.67em; 
    margin-left: 0; 
    margin-right: 0; 
    font-weight: bold; 
} 
h2 { 
    display: block; 
    font-size: 1.5em; 
    margin-top: 0.83em; 
    margin-bottom: 0.83em; 
    margin-left: 0; 
    margin-right: 0; 
    font-weight: bold; 
} 
h3 { 
    display: block; 
    font-size: 1.17em; 
    margin-top: 1em; 
    margin-bottom: 1em; 
    margin-left: 0; 
    margin-right: 0; 
    font-weight: bold; 
} 
h4 { 
    display: block; 
    margin-top: 1.33em; 
    margin-bottom: 1.33em; 
    margin-left: 0; 
    margin-right: 0; 
    font-weight: bold; 
} 
h5 { 
    display: block; 
    font-size: .83em; 
    margin-top: 1.67em; 
    margin-bottom: 1.67em; 
    margin-left: 0; 
    margin-right: 0; 
    font-weight: bold; 
} 
h6 { 
    display: block; 
    font-size: .67em; 
    margin-top: 2.33em; 
    margin-bottom: 2.33em; 
    margin-left: 0; 
    margin-right: 0; 
    font-weight: bold; 
} 
+0

謝謝。完美的回答。我正在尋找以上材料:) – fatherazrael

+1

@fatherazrael我看到你現在在找什麼。在這種情況下,如果可能的話,你應該重新提出你的問題或標題,以便閱讀*標題標籤的默認CSS樣式?* – Lee

+0

@Lee 正如建議我改變了問題。 – fatherazrael

0

將您想要的屬性添加到您希望該屬性影響的類,標識或元素。

0

問題:CSS中有相同的預定義屬性嗎?

沒有

你可以嘗試這樣的:

h3{ 
    display: block; 
} 

h3 { 
    font-size: /*Font size similar to h3*/ ; 
} 
2

是否有在CSS相同的預定義的財產;這與H給出的外觀和感覺相同?

標題的默認樣式是(在大多數瀏覽器)正是這樣:不同的CSS規則集合再加上Hn選擇器(和存儲在瀏覽器的樣式表)。

沒有(純CSS)方法來自動複製所有這些規則。

您可以使用內置於大多數瀏覽器中的開發人員工具中的Inspector工具來檢查標題並查看其默認規則,然後將這些規則複製到您自己的(作者)樣式表中。

瀏覽器之間可能會有一些差異,所以您通常也要明確設置Hn規則。

+0

您可以使用javascript。請參閱http://stackoverflow.com/questions/754607/can-jquery-get-all-css-styles-associated-with-an-element/6416527#6416527 –

-1

認爲一個好的做法是令h < 1-6>保持自己的默認樣式。然後添加一個類來添加其他樣式。對我來說看起來很乾淨,而且你不會竊聽「主人風格」。優點和缺點我相信。

< H1類= 「H1」>你好CSS </H1>

相關問題